#e297d4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e297d4 is composed of 88.6% red, 59.2%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.2% magenta, 6.2%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 311.2 degrees, a saturation of 56.4% and a lightness of 73.9%. #e297d4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c52fa9.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#e297d4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030103 is the darkest color, while #fcf3fa is the lightest one.
